Title: The Innovations of Ming-Chu Hou
Introduction
Ming-Chu Hou is a notable inventor based in Taipei, Taiwan. He has made significant contributions to the field of electronics through his innovative designs and patents. With a total of 2 patents, his work focuses on enhancing the functionality and efficiency of electronic products.
Latest Patents
Ming-Chu Hou's latest patents include an EMI shielding device and a modular stack device. The EMI shielding device is designed to protect electronic products from electromagnetic interference (EMI). It features a U-shaped component embedded within the housing of the product, which connects and secures the anti-EMI device. Additionally, a spring component is utilized to effectively shield the EMI, extending from the U-shaped component and protruding from the product housing.
The modular stack device comprises at least one stack module, which includes a U-shaped member, a mounting pad, a mounting stud, and a positioning component. The U-shaped member is responsible for holding a casing and is designed with an upper wall, a bottom wall, and a side wall. The mounting pad and mounting stud are strategically placed on the exterior of the bottom and upper walls, respectively. This design allows for multiple stack modules to be connected, facilitating the stacking of several casings.
